I went to the doctor on FRiday... my first appt since my diagnosis on Jan 13th...
I didn't start my meds right away.. but after 3 weeks of not the kind of control I wanted.. and after everyone here helped me with my fears.... I started my meds... have been on Metformin 2 a day 500mg for 6 weeks...
My initial BGL was 225... my A1C was 8.0 ... as of March 16th.. my BGL was 95 and my A1C was 6.7!! I had complained to my doc that I still wasn't getting the control I wanted, so he up'd my meds to 3 a day (500mg).... and so far, my control has been much better... I'm back to intestinal problems but I think after day 3 its starting to subside also...

I feel much better.... I've asked my doctor if I can go on the extended release Metformin.. he said next visit, in 6 weeks, we'll discuss it... I'm hopeful....
